Tottenham Hotspur star Richarlison is a prime target for Saudi Pro League clubs, as per The Telegraph.

The Brazilian striker was already on the Saudis' radar last January, but no official offers were submitted at the time. 

Al-Ittihad are believed to be the main candidate in the race for the 26-year-old who is valued at around £60 million.

Richarlison who is still recovering from a knee injury has 11 goals and three assists in 26 appearances for Spurs across all competitions this season.

His current deal at Tottenham expires in the summer of 2027.

The Saudis are ready to launch bids for other stars from the Premier League as well. 

Liverpool winger Mohamed Salah and Manchester City midfielder Kevin De Bruyne have already been linked with the SPL.
